开发服务器是一种专门用于软件开发和测试的服务器,通常用于构建、测试和调试应用程序的代码和功能。它在软件开发团队中起着关键作用,为开发人员提供了一个安全、稳定和独立的环境来进行开发工作。
源代码管理:开发服务器通常配备源代码管理工具,如Git或SVN,用于存储和管理应用程序的源代码。
构建和编译:开发服务器支持自动化构建和编译应用程序,以确保代码的正确性和一致性。
测试环境:开发服务器提供一个测试环境,供开发人员进行单元测试、集成测试和功能测试等。
调试功能:开发服务器通常配备调试功能,以便开发人员可以定位和解决代码中的问题和错误。
模拟环境:开发服务器可以模拟不同的运行环境,如生产环境或演示环境,以帮助开发人员测试和验证应用程序的性能和功能。
隔离环境:开发服务器与生产服务器相互隔离,确保开发人员的工作不会影响实际运行的生产环境。
版本控制:开发服务器允许开发团队对代码进行版本控制,以便进行追踪和回滚。
安全性:开发服务器需要采取相应的安全措施,保护代码和数据不受未经授权的访问和攻击。
数据库管理:开发服务器通常配备数据库管理系统,用于存储和管理应用程序的数据。
总体而言,开发服务器是一个重要的工具,用于支持软件开发团队高效、安全地进行应用程序的开发和测试工作。它可以帮助开发人员快速开发、测试和交付高质量的应用程序。